Title

THE EFFECT OF C-BAR SPLINT ON HAND FUNCTION IN 8-12 YEARS OLD SPASTIC DIPLEGIC CHILDREN

Pages

  22-27

Abstract

 Background and Aim: Cerebral palsy (CP) is a neurodevelopmental disorder caused by nonprogressive lesions. This disorder produces motor impairment deficits in early infancy. HAND FUNCTION is essential in performing activities of daily living for everyone, including individuals with cerebral palsy. Adequate first web space is essential for web space expansion, thumb abduction, and a wide range of thumb mobility and HAND FUNCTION. The purpose of this study was to determine the effects of C-BAR SPLINT on HAND FUNCTION and strength and also wrist and thumb range of motion (ROM) of dominant hand of 8-12 years old children with spastic diplegic cerebral palsy.Materials and Methods: The design of this study was before- after and quasi-experimental. According with inclusion criteria, 8 to 12 years old children with spastic diplegia from physical – motor special school at Tehran (8 boys and 5 girls), were studied. They used a C-BAR SPLINT (40 degree of palmer abduction of thumb) for 8 weeks (6-8 hours during day and 4-6 hours at night). In this study, HAND FUNCTION was evaluated by Jebsen Taylor HAND FUNCTION Test, hand strength by MIE dynamometer and thumb & wrist ROM by Goniometer. During intervention, they received routine occupational therapy program.Results: The results of this study showed significant improvement in HAND FUNCTION (P=0.001), and thumb range of motion (P=0.02). The data did not show any significant improvement in wrist ROM and hand strength.Conclusion: According to the result of this study, it seems that using C-BAR SPLINT can be an effective method in improvement of HAND FUNCTION and thumb ROM in 8-12 years old children with spastic diplegia.
